什么是VDS模拟器? VDS模拟器是一种用于创建和模拟虚拟设备环境的软件工具,它能够模拟各种移动设备、桌面设备或嵌入式设备的操作系统和硬件特性。通过VDS模拟器,开发者可以在无需实际硬件的情况下,测试应用程序在不同设备上的运行情况,确保应用兼容性和稳定性。
VDS模拟器的核心功能包括设备配置模拟、操作系统模拟、网络环境模拟以及传感器模拟等。开发者可以自定义设备的屏幕尺寸、分辨率、处理器型号、内存大小等参数,以模拟不同类型的设备。同时,VDS模拟器还能模拟不同的网络条件,如不同速度的Wi-Fi、4G或5G网络,以及网络延迟和丢包情况,帮助测试应用在网络不佳环境下的表现。此外,VDS模拟器可以模拟设备的电池状态、摄像头、GPS、加速度计等传感器数据,让应用测试更加全面。
VDS模拟器在开发过程中具有显著优势。首先,它大幅降低了硬件成本,开发者无需购买大量不同型号的设备进行测试,节省了采购和维护费用。其次,VDS模拟器提高了测试效率,可以在短时间内模拟大量设备场景,快速发现和修复问题。再者,VDS模拟器支持自动化测试,可以集成到持续集成(CI)流程中,自动执行测试用例,提高测试的重复性和准确性。最后,VDS模拟器提供了灵活的调试功能,开发者可以直接在模拟器中查看应用的运行日志、内存使用情况等,便于快速定位和解决问题。
在应用场景方面,VDS模拟器广泛应用于移动应用开发领域。对于iOS和Android应用,开发者需要测试应用在不同设备上的兼容性,VDS模拟器可以模拟不同版本的iOS和Android系统,以及不同品牌和型号的设备,确保应用在各种设备上都能正常运行。此外,VDS模拟器也适用于Web应用开发,测试Web应用在不同浏览器(如Chrome、Firefox、Safari)和不同设备上的显示效果和性能。对于企业级应用,VDS模拟器可以模拟不同类型的虚拟设备,测试应用在不同环境下的稳定性和安全性,保障企业数据的安全。
随着技术的不断发展,VDS模拟器也在不断演进。现代VDS模拟器支持更真实的模拟体验,如通过虚拟化技术实现更接近真实设备的性能,支持实时渲染和交互,让测试结果更加可靠。同时,VDS模拟器与云服务的结合,使得开发者可以随时随地访问和管理虚拟设备,提高了开发的灵活性和效率。未来,VDS模拟器可能会进一步集成人工智能技术,自动分析测试结果,提供智能化的测试建议,帮助开发者更高效地优化应用。